This rating has improved by 7% over the last 12 months. WebChina’s Children International (CCI) is an international organization created by and for Chinese adoptees. Founded in 2011, its mission is to empower Chinese adoptees from all over the world by creating an inclusive and supportive community for all of us who share this common beginning.
